Pavement leveling services involve the process of correcting uneven or sunken surfaces of asphalt or concrete pavements. Over time, pavements can develop cracks, dips, or cracks due to natural settling, soil movement, or aging materials. The service typically includes assessing the affected areas, removing or breaking up damaged sections, and then re-leveling or re-compacting the surface to restore a smooth, even appearance. This process helps improve the safety and functionality of driveways, walkways, parking lots, and other paved surfaces.
These services address common problems such as trip hazards, water pooling, and accelerated deterioration of the pavement. When surfaces become uneven, they can pose safety risks for pedestrians and vehicles, especially in high-traffic areas. Additionally, water pooling caused by uneven surfaces can lead to further damage, including cracks and potholes, which may require more extensive repairs if left unaddressed. Pavement leveling helps maintain the integrity of the surface, prolonging its lifespan and reducing the need for costly repairs in the future.

Basic Pavement Leveling - costs typically range from $1 to $3 per square foot, with average projects around $2 per square foot for minor adjustments. For example, a 1,000-square-foot driveway may cost between $1,000 and $3,000. Prices vary depending on the extent of the unevenness and surface condition.
Moderate to Extensive Leveling - more significant repairs can cost between $3 and $6 per square foot, totaling roughly $3,000 to $6,000 for larger areas. This includes leveling surfaces with substantial dips or cracks requiring additional preparation or materials. Costs depend on the severity and size of the pavement.
Material and Equipment Costs - expenses for materials like asphalt or concrete and specialized equipment can influence overall pricing, often adding a few hundred dollars to the project. For smaller jobs, material costs might be around $200 to $500, while larger projects may require more extensive resource investment.
Project Size and Complexity - larger or more complex leveling projects tend to increase costs, with prices potentially exceeding $10,000 for extensive areas requiring extensive preparation. Local service providers typically provide estimates based on the specific scope and conditions of each project.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
